Flood — Gibson, IN

Dec 1, 2011

December was among the wettest Decembers of record. River flooding continued for the entire month along portions of the Wabash and White Rivers. The heaviest and most widespread rain event of the month occurred on the 4th and 5th, when 3 to 4 inches was common. After nearly ten days with little or no precipitation, significant rain returned to the Wabash and White basins by the middle of the month.

Source: NOAA National Weather Service Storm Events Database (event 356427). Narrative written by NWS staff at the time of the event.
